You don't have to like cricket to like this film A very entertaining story set in London in the fifties with a backdrop of the racial tension of the time, which is handled sensibly and with sensitivity, mainly featuring on a young Jewish lad who loves to play cricket but is not what you'd call good at it and the relationship he forms with his two new West Indian neighbours. A film that just makes you smile throughout. A typically good British independent film.
